md> hi,


md> kinit: Retry count exceeded (send_to_kdc)

md> anyone have a hint?

Here is a hint from my book I am writing. If you did a fresh install
of KerberosIV, the error Retry count exceeded is nothing special and
happens on a lot of machines. Try this: restart your server (yes!), start kerberos manually.

Tip: dont use kerberosIV! If you really dont need Kerberos, dont use
it.
